Hundreds Of Bikers Take Part In 9/11 Memorial Ride Through Manhattan

NEW YORK (CBSNewYork) – Weeks before the anniversary of the Sept. 11 terror attacks, hundreds of bikers from around the country rode to New York City to make sure no one forgets.

More than 700 motorcyclists rode through Manhattan Sunday on a mission to honor the lives of victims, CBS 2’s Don Champion reported.

“It’s a very emotional ride,” said Roger Flick, with America’s 9/11 Foundation.

The final leg of the group’s journey took them from their hotel in Midtown to the Sept. 11 memorial site in Lower Manhattan.
